Indonesian traditional dance, or "tari tradisional," is a stunning display of color, movement, and storytelling. The elegant movements of the Bedhaya dance from Yogyakarta, the energetic beats of the Kecak dance from Bali, and the dramatic flair of the Merak dance from West Java are just a few examples of the rich cultural heritage of Indonesian dance.

Indonesian music, known as "musik Indonesia," is a dynamic fusion of traditional and modern styles. From the nostalgic sounds of dangdut, a genre that originated in the 1970s, to the contemporary vibes of Indonesian pop and rock, there's something for every musical taste. Artists like Isyana Sarasvati, Raisa, and Nidji have gained international recognition, while local musicians like Rhoma Irama and Titiek Puspa continue to inspire new generations.
